Isaiah 64:8-10
International Standard Version
God, our Father, will Act
8 But as for you,[a] O Lord, you are our Father;
and[b] we are clay,[c]
and you are our potter;
we are all the work of your hands.[d]
9 Don’t be angry beyond measure, Lord,
and don’t remember our iniquity for a season.[e]
Please look now, we are all your people.
10 Your holy cities have become a desert;
Zion has become like[f] a desert,
Jerusalem a desolation.
Footnotes
- Isaiah 64:8 So 1QIsaa; MT LXX read But now
- Isaiah 64:8 So 1QIsaa LXX; MT lacks and
- Isaiah 64:8 So 1QIsaa LXX; 1QIsab MT read the clay
- Isaiah 64:8 So 1QIsaa LXX; MT reads your hand
- Isaiah 64:9 So 1QIsaa LXX; MT reads for ever
- Isaiah 64:10 So 1QIsaa LXX; 1QIsab MT lack like
Isaiah 64:8-10
New International Version
8 Yet you, Lord, are our Father.(A)
We are the clay, you are the potter;(B)
we are all the work of your hand.(C)
9 Do not be angry(D) beyond measure, Lord;
do not remember our sins(E) forever.
Oh, look on us, we pray,
for we are all your people.(F)
10 Your sacred cities(G) have become a wasteland;
even Zion is a wasteland, Jerusalem a desolation.(H)
